Took the opportunity to observe the Nova V462 Lupi tonight using a 102mm f7 ED and a 24mm WA eyepiece, thanks to some clear calm skies for a change. Estimated the visual magnitude at 5.6 / 5.7 , comparing it to the adjacent field stars, so it may still be brightening. Using the AAVSO finder chart and Stellarium made it quite easy to find and estimate the magnitude. Will be interesting to see how my guess compares to more experienced nova observers.
